O que é Log Analysis?
Log Analysis, ou Análise de Logs, refere-se ao processo de examinar e interpretar os registros gerados por sistemas de computador, servidores, aplicativos e dispositivos de rede. Esses logs contêm informações cruciais sobre o funcionamento e o desempenho de um sistema, permitindo que técnicos e administradores identifiquem problemas, monitorem atividades e realizem auditorias de segurança. A análise de logs é uma prática essencial para a manutenção da integridade e eficiência de sistemas de TI.
Importância da Análise de Logs
A Análise de Logs é fundamental para a detecção de falhas e anomalias em sistemas de computação. Ao monitorar os logs, é possível identificar padrões de comportamento que podem indicar problemas, como falhas de hardware, erros de software ou tentativas de invasão. Além disso, a análise contínua dos logs ajuda na otimização do desempenho do sistema, permitindo ajustes que melhoram a eficiência e a segurança.
Tipos de Logs
Existem diversos tipos de logs que podem ser analisados, incluindo logs de sistema, logs de aplicativo, logs de segurança e logs de rede. Cada tipo de log fornece informações específicas que podem ser úteis para diferentes propósitos. Por exemplo, os logs de segurança registram eventos relacionados a tentativas de acesso e autenticação, enquanto os logs de sistema oferecem detalhes sobre o funcionamento interno do sistema operacional.
Ferramentas de Log Analysis
Para realizar uma análise eficaz dos logs, existem várias ferramentas disponíveis no mercado. Softwares como Splunk, ELK Stack (Elasticsearch, Logstash e Kibana) e Graylog são amplamente utilizados para coletar, armazenar e analisar dados de logs. Essas ferramentas oferecem recursos avançados de visualização e relatórios, facilitando a identificação de tendências e problemas em grandes volumes de dados.
Processo de Análise de Logs
O processo de Log Analysis geralmente envolve a coleta de dados, a normalização das informações, a análise propriamente dita e a geração de relatórios. A coleta de dados pode ser feita em tempo real ou em intervalos programados, enquanto a normalização garante que os dados sejam apresentados de forma consistente. A análise pode incluir a busca por padrões, a correlação de eventos e a identificação de anomalias.
Desafios na Análise de Logs
A Análise de Logs pode apresentar desafios significativos, especialmente em ambientes com grandes volumes de dados. A quantidade de informações geradas pode ser avassaladora, tornando difícil a identificação de eventos relevantes. Além disso, a diversidade de formatos de logs e a necessidade de integração entre diferentes fontes de dados podem complicar o processo de análise.
Log Analysis e Segurança da Informação
A Análise de Logs desempenha um papel crucial na segurança da informação. Através da monitorização constante dos logs, é possível detectar atividades suspeitas e responder rapidamente a incidentes de segurança. A análise de logs também é uma prática recomendada para auditorias de conformidade, ajudando as organizações a manterem-se em conformidade com regulamentos e normas de segurança.
Benefícios da Análise de Logs
Os benefícios da Análise de Logs são vastos e incluem a melhoria da segurança, a otimização do desempenho do sistema e a capacidade de realizar diagnósticos precisos. Além disso, a análise de logs pode ajudar na tomada de decisões informadas, fornecendo dados que suportam a implementação de melhorias e a resolução de problemas de forma proativa.
Futuro da Análise de Logs
Com o avanço da tecnologia e o aumento da complexidade dos sistemas de TI, a Análise de Logs continuará a evoluir. A integração de inteligência artificial e aprendizado de máquina promete transformar a forma como os logs são analisados, permitindo uma detecção de anomalias mais rápida e precisa. Assim, a Análise de Logs se tornará ainda mais vital para a segurança e a eficiência operacional das organizações.